39 Upper Barn Copse, Fair Oak, Eastleigh, SO50 8DB is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1991-1995. The property offers approximately 721 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have two b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£311,127 , which equates to approximately £431 per square foot. It was last sold on 21 Jun 2010 for £179,000. Since then, the value has increased by £132,127, representing a 73.8% increase, or approximately 4.8% per year.

The current estimated value of £311,127 is:

  • 31.2% lower than the average property price on Upper Barn Copse
  • 33.0% lower than the average in the SO50 8DB postcode area
  • and 5.1% lower than the average price for Eastleigh as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 2 March 2023, the property was recorded as rented.

39 Upper Barn Copse, Fair Oak, Eastleigh, Hampshire, SO50 8DB has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 2 Mar 2023.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 21 Oct 2008. The rating of D is unchanged, though the energy efficiency score decreased by 1.5%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, insulated (assumed) to cavity wall, filled cavity,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 50%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from good to very good.
